  • Best Leather Pants

    I have a pair of First Gear leather pants I've been wearing around for about a year. I've read some reviews around online and I was wondering who makes the best leathers - especially the pants. Does anyone have any insight on this? I don't want to drop 300 bucks on a pair of pants only to have them come apart on me. The last thing I want is to literally lose my a$$ both at the store and on the street.

        I don't know who's best, but having a pair that zips to your jacket is a must in my opinion.

        I have the JR perforated Speedmasters and love them.

        there's also (in no special order)

        HJC
        AGV
        Teknic
        Spyke
        Spidi
        Fieldsheer
        Frank Thomas

        You can go to a site like motorcyclegearreview but mostly they are just write ups about comfort, fit and apearance. Personally I'd prefer some first hand crash experience. That's why I always ask people who post of a crash to post pics of thier gear and say how it held up.

              I have Vanson chaps that I crashed in..
              Low side face down slide.. Tore through the toe of my shoe.. But to this day I can't see any damage to the chaps..
